What they do
to BE AN ASSOCIATION of CONTRACTORS and RELATED BUSINESSES COMMITTED to PROMOTING THE BALANCED INTERESTS of ITS MEMBERS and ADVOCATING THE HIGHEST STANDARDS of QUALITY, PROFESSIONALISM, SAFETY, and ETHICS. THIS is ACHIEVED THROUGH THE PROVIDING of TRAINING, THE DISSEMINATION of INFORMATION, and ACTING AS A REPRESENTATIVE AT THE STATE LEVEL.

Money made simple
Ask these three easy questions
- Who did you help? Ask for a recent story or report that shows real results.
- What will my money do? Ask exactly what your gift will pay for.
- Is this really the charity? Give only through its official website or confirmed phone number.
Pay context: The highest compensation shown in this filing is $181,570 for FLAGG KELLY (EXECUTIVE DIRECTOR). Compare pay with organizations of similar size and complexity.
Bottom line: Do not decide from a name, mission statement, or tax status alone. Look at where the money went, then ask what changed, who was helped, and what your gift will do. YouCanGiveBack does not endorse or grade organizations.
